Sport Palace Alkmaar
In the year 2003 the former semi covered cycle track of Alkmaar was transformed into a sports palace. The originally concrete track was replaced by a wooden track and the roof became totally covered. The inside area of the track can be used for all kinds of indoor sports and events like concerts or exhibitions. After the completion of the renovation the sports palace is home for the national track cycling team of the Netherlands including the world champions Theo Bos and Teun Mulder.
